MISCELLANEOUS:
If you are claiming a diminished earning capacity since the entry of the Final Judgment
sought to be modified as grounds to modify alimony or deviate from the child support
established in your case, describe in detail how your earning capacity is lowered and state
all facts upon which you rely in your claim. If unemployed, state how, why, and when
you lost your job.
If you are claiming a change in a mental or physical condition since the entry of the Final
Judgment sought to be modified as grounds to modify alimony or change the child
support established in your case, describe in detail how your mental and/or physical
capacity has changed and state all facts upon which you rely in your claim. Identify the
change in your mental and/or physical capacity, and state the name and address of all
health care providers involved in the treatment of this mental or physical condition.
If you are requesting a change in shared or sole parental responsibility, primary
residency, the parenting schedule, or any combination thereof, for the minor child(ren),
describe in detail the change in circumstances since the entry of the Final Judgment
sought to be modified that you feel justify the requested change. State when the change of
circumstances occurred, how the change of circumstances affects the child(ren), and why
it is in the best interests of the child(ren) that the Court make the requested change.
Attach your parenting schedule.
If you do not feel the requested change in shared or sole parental responsibility, primary
residency, the parenting schedule, or any combination thereof, for the minor child(ren) is
in their best interests, describe in detail any facts since the entry of the Final Judgment
sought to be modified that you feel justify the Court denying the requested change. State,
in your opinion, what change, if any, of the parenting arrangement is justified or
agreeable to you and why it is in the best interests of the child(ren).
